Engineered Wood Installation in Longmont, CO

Engineered wood installation involves carefully placing and securing engineered wood flooring, panels, or other structures to enhance the appearance and functionality of interior spaces. This service covers a variety of projects such as updating living rooms, kitchens, basements, or creating custom features like built-in shelving and wall panels.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of engineered wood available, the preparation required for installation, and how the finished product will complement their existing décor and structural needs.

Homeowners considering engineered wood installation usually seek information about the durability and maintenance of the materials, as well as the scope of work involved. It’s important to clarify whether the project includes subfloor preparation, the installation process, and any finishing touches needed to ensure a smooth, long-lasting result. Understanding these details helps property owners plan effectively and select the right engineered wood solutions for their specific space and aesthetic preferences.

FAQ

Engineered Wood Installation Questions

What types of projects are suitable for engineered wood installation? Engineered wood is ideal for flooring, wall accents, and custom staircases in residential and commercial spaces in Longmont, CO.

How durable is engineered wood compared to traditional hardwood? Engineered wood offers excellent durability and stability, making it suitable for areas with fluctuating humidity and temperature.

What preparations are needed before installing engineered wood? The installation area should be clean, level, and dry to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.

Can engineered wood be installed over existing flooring? Yes, engineered wood can often be installed over existing flooring, provided the surface is stable and suitable for new material.
